Job Summary

The primary purpose of the Assistant Director of Nursing Services position is to assist the Director of Nursing Services in directing and supervising the day-to-day activities of the facility in accordance with local, state, and federal guidelines and regulations. This position is charged with the responsibility to assure that consistent quality care is delivered to the patient/resident population. As Assistant Director of Nursing Services, this position is delegated the administrative authority, responsibility, and accountability necessary for carrying out the assigned duties.

Qualifications

  • A current and valid license is maintained in the applicable State.
  • Minimum of two years charge nurse and supervisory experience in a long term care setting is preferred.
  • Ability to read, write, and speak the English language.

Essential Functions

  • Under the direction of the Director of Nursing Services, assists in directing and coordinating the day-to-day functions of the nursing care to patients/residents in accordance with state and federal rules, regulations, and standard nursing practices.
  • Assists in ensuring the provision of treatments, medications, and nursing services according to a patient's/residents care plan and physician directed orders.
  • May participate in annual evaluation and, if necessary, disciplinary counsel/action in accordance with Cantex's Hiring and Retention Manual.
  • Assists in assuring the essential weekly and/or monthly committee meetings are held in accordance with Cantex's Clinical Policies and Procedures and Patient/resident Care Management Systems (i.e., Skin, Falls, Restraints, Weights, Assessments, and Quality Assurance Committees).
  • Conducts frequent rounds daily to ensure that all nursing service personnel are performing their essential functions in accordance with Cantex's Clinical Policy and State/Federal guidelines and regulations.
  • Assures that each patient's accident or incident is fully documented and reported in accordance with Cantex's Clinical Policies and Procedures, Patient/resident Care Management Systems and state/federal guidelines and regulations.
  • Assures that each patient's attending physician and family or responsible party is promptly notified of any significant change in the patient's health condition.
  • Ability to function as a Team Leader/Role Model.
  • Take call periodically or as specifically needed by facility.
  • Ensures that all Nursing Service personnel comply with the procedures set forth in the Cantex Clinical Policies and Procedures.
  • Has reviewed Cantex Healthcare's Clinical Policies and Procedures for Abuse Prevention and knows the employee's responsibility to enforce it.
  • Responsible for assuring patient/resident safety.
  • Performs other duties and tasks as assigned by the Director of Nursing.
  • Ensures Patient/resident Care Management Systems are routinely in-serviced and incorporated into the delivery of patient/resident care.
  • Contributes to the orientation and professional development of the nursing staff.
  • Completes employee evaluations on either an annual basis or post probationary period; as well as provides counsel or disciplinary action when appropriate.
